Question

The diagram shows a cone. The radius of its base is 2.8 cm and its slant height is 8cm. Find the area of its curved surface (π=227).

Solution
Verified by Toppr

Given, radius r=2.8cm
and slant height l=8cm.

Then,
curved surface area =πrl
=227×2.8×8=70.4cm2.

Therefore, option A is correct.
